iPhone News - Microsoft to Finally Challenge the iPhone news - Tue Feb 16, 2010 7:37 am Post subject: Microsoft to Finally Challenge the iPhone
The rumored Zune Phone is a reality, and if the early buzz has anything to say, Microsoft is well on its way to releasing a very capable product worthy of